Transaction 720dc7861c776f85b2b3792925154f74a4c21822cf25dd665466b6481d68454a
4 Input
2 Outputs
- 720dc7861c776f85b2b3792925154f74a4c21822cf25dd665466b6481d68454a:0
- 720dc7861c776f85b2b3792925154f74a4c21822cf25dd665466b6481d68454a:1
value 50000000
address 32AASxJgjPzJ8o6WotFdCCVzEXLxHxgKzN
value 50582218
address 3BMEXQM1XeYwNvyMy1kbUhogbWPtpFPNDu